SITREP: Spirit Airlines has announced it will cease operations due to ongoing financial difficulties. The airline had been attempting to secure a $500 million financial support package from the federal government, but negotiations were unsuccessful. TACTICAL ASSESSMENT: The cessation of Spirit Airlines operations may lead to increased competition among remaining carriers, potentially affecting air travel prices and availability. This development could also have broader implications for the airline industry, particularly for low-cost carriers facing similar financial pressures. PROJECTED VECTORS: It is likely that other low-cost airlines may face scrutiny and potential operational challenges as a result of Spirit's exit from the market.
